![]() ![]() It seems that most DB tools are not updated with last changes and still produce old format queries If you see this warning your can solve it just by removing: SET PASSWORD FOR =PASSWORD('1234') 1287 'SET PASSWORD FOR = PASSWORD('')' is deprecated and will be removed in a future release. In case that you are trying to change your root password(or other user password without success you can check previous section. So, run:ĪLTER USER IDENTIFIED WITH mysql_native_password BY 'test' įor more information you can check the link in references 1699 SET PASSWORD has no significance for user as authentication plugin does not support it. First changing the plugin and then setting the password won’t work, and it will fall back to auth_socket again. This is a new change since 5.7: If we want to configure a password, we need to change the plugin and set the password at the same time, in the same command. ![]() One of the reasons to not be able to connect would be: auth_socket plugin. It's advisable to create another DBA user while playing with these settings. If you remove your root password or set it to null then you may experience problems when you try to connect with root. MySQL problems related to root authentication Not able to connect with root and no password Or removing the root password: ALTER USER IDENTIFIED WITH mysql_native_password BY '' If you can log in to your MySQL server and you wanto to change your password by query you can do it by: ALTER USER IDENTIFIED WITH mysql_native_password BY '123456' Server version: 5.7.23-0ubuntu0.18.04.1 (Ubuntu)Īfter successful login you can select any of the other sections or just remove the root password by: ALTER USER IDENTIFIED WITH mysql_native_password BY '' Īnd restart mysql server by(optional): sudo systemctl stop mysql Login in MySQL with your OS account password by:Īfter entering your user OS password you could be asked for MySQL root password - enter nothing and finally you will enter in MySQL server: sudo mysql -u root -p.In order to log in your MySQL server and create new user or get access to your DB you can do: If you try to log in you will get an error like:Īccess denied for user (using password: YES) On fresh installation on Linux Mint 19 and Ubuntu 18.04 you can see that MySQL server is installed by default. Please use SET PASSWORD FOR = References'' insteadĪccess denied for user (using password: YES) after new installation on Ubuntu/Linux Mint 1287 'SET PASSWORD FOR = PASSWORD('')' is deprecated and will be removed in a future release.1699 SET PASSWORD has no significance for user as authentication plugin does not support it. ![]() Not able to connect with root and no password.MySQL problems related to root authentication.Access denied for user (using password: YES) after new installation on Ubuntu/Linux Mint.Here, you have to use the FLUSH PRIVILEGE statement after executing an UPDATE statement for reloading privileges from the grant table of the MySQL database.Reset of MySQL password can be done in several ways depending of the: This statement is the first way to change the user password for updating the user table of the MySQL database. Let us see how we can change the user account password in MySQL by using the above statement in detail:Ĭhange user account password using the UPDATE statement MySQL allows us to change the user account password in three different ways, which are given below: If you reset the user account password without changing an application connection string, then the application cannot connect with the database server. An application used by the user whose password you want to change.The details of the user account that you want to change.To change the password of any user account, you must have to keep this information in your mind: ![]() In some cases, there is a need to change the user password in the MySQL database. The login information includes the user name and password. MySQL user is a record that contains the login information, account privileges, and the host information for MySQL account to access and manage the database.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|